The Java 1.6 runtime bundled with OpenSolaris runs without libXm or those
font packages - Oracle just has a bad habit of forcing their installers
to run with whatever ancient JVM they bundled with them.

> Am Samstag, den 11.10.2008, 10:22 -0700 schrieb Alan Coopersmith:
>> Jürgen Lüters wrote:
>>> Hi,
>>> i am trying to install oracle 10.2 on snv98. Oracle requires the
>>> packages SUNWi1of and SUNWxwfnt.
>>>
>>> Please make this packages available via pkg install.
>> Those packages can't be made available via pkg install at the moment,
>> as they contain fonts which are commercially licensed and
>> non-redistributable. SUNWi1of has also been recently removed from
>> Nevada & SXCE as well.
>>
>> It's strange that a database server depends on specific font packages.
> Even worse they depend on libm as well. And all this probably for a java
> database installer which does run on non-Motif platforms ( Debian
> GNU/Linux) without any problems.
>
> "Preparing to launch Oracle Universal Installer
> from /tmp/OraInstall2008-10-11_04-05-52PM. Please
> wait [EMAIL PROTECTED]:/u04/database$ Exception in thread "main"
> java.lang.UnsatisfiedLinkError:
> /tmp/OraInstall2008-10-11_04-05-52PM/jre/1.4.2/lib/i386/motif21/libmawt.so:
> ld.so.1: java: fatal: libXm.so.4: open failed: No such file or directory"
>
> This is somewhat fatal for OpenSolaris as a Oracle database server. We
> might have to get to Solaris 10. Maybe Sun should talk to Oracle.
